Job Description

Donovan Marine is a world class wholesale marine supply company servicing all of New York state. We are looking to add hard working and driven individuals to our team of drivers.

Delivery drivers for the Finger Lakes and surrounding areas

Position is seasonable, work thru November 21st depending on workload

Should be based in the Farmington area

Home nights and weekends

20 - 40+ hours a week

Pay rate: $22.00

Required availability:

Tuesday thru Friday

Ideal candidate should be able to drive vehicles ranging from a van to a 20' straight truck, and meet the following job requirements:
  • Self-starter
  • Have reliable transportation
  • Highschool diploma or equivalent
  • CDL B license (preferred but not required)
  • Clean driving record
  • Lift at least 50 lbs. and move packages up to 500 lbs. safely using supplied equipment
Ability to use the following equipment:
  • pallet jack
  • hydraulic fold away liftgate
  • drum / barrel cart
  • e-track load straps and load bars
